Serving 620 students in grades Prekindergarten-9, Profesora Juana Rosario Carrero 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Puerto Rico for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 10% (which is lower than the Puerto Rico state average of 23%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 44% (which is higher than the Puerto Rico state average of 36%).
The student-teacher ratio of 12:1 is higher than the Puerto Rico state level of 10:1.
Minority enrollment is 99%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Puerto Rico state average of 100% (majority Hispanic).

School Overview

Profesora Juana Rosario Carrero's student population of 620 students has declined by 9% over five school years.
The teacher population of 50 teachers has grown by 19% over five school years.
